M.S in Pharmaceutical Sciences at University of Arizona Overview
International students can pursue University of Arizona M.S in Pharmaceutical Sciences at PG level. The duration of the course at the university is 18 to 24 months. The course is among the top-ranked courses in the country.
International students must meet the entry requirements such as complete academic qualification, a valid test score in exams such as IELTS, TOEFL and PTE to be eligible for the course. The University of Arizona fees for international students for M.S in Pharmaceutical Sciences is around USD 32,226 for first-year. M.S in Pharmaceutical Sciences at University of Arizona Fees
The first-year University of Arizona fees for M.S in Pharmaceutical Sciences is around USD 32,226.
Besides the tuition cost, students must also consider the living costs, which includes accommodation, meals, travel expenses, course materials and supplies, and other miscellaneous expenses. For overseas students, the cost of living is around USD 14,068. However, it varies as per the lifestyle of students.

M.S in Pharmaceutical Sciences at University of Arizona Highlights
- The goal of the MS program is to provide the student with the essential skills and abilities to assume managerial and leadership positions related to the economic analysis, outcomes of pharmaceuticals, pharmaceutical services, and health care in health care organizations, government agencies, pharmaceutical companies, and academic institutions
- Students will receive an MS degree in pharmaceutical sciences emphasis in health and pharmaceutical outcomes
- It is available with following concentrations: Drug Discovery & Development, Health and Pharm Outcomes, Pharm Econ Policy & Outcomes and Pharmacokinetics/Pharmaceutics
